AI Technical Summary
Existing scaffolding is complicated to assemble and disassemble in complex and variable installation spaces, and cannot be flexibly adjusted, resulting in low material reuse rate and poor versatility.
A flexible and easy-to-load construction scaffold was designed, which adopts a multi-layer support unit structure. The support unit includes hollow vertical poles, support plates, pole-plate connecting seats and telescopic connecting pipes. The telescopic connecting pipes and locking devices realize the flexible connection and fixation between support plates. The support plates are equipped with connecting grooves and gear transmission to increase stability and ease of adjustment.
It improves the versatility and stability of scaffolding, simplifies loading and unloading operations, shortens erection time, increases construction efficiency, reduces material damage, and is suitable for complex and ever-changing construction sites.
